I cant view certain webpages on my device?


So here's the whole story.

Yesterday, I was unable to surf the net since most of the pages wont load, but the thing is, youtube was the only one that worked fine with my net and I was even watching those videos in 720p-uninterrupted and smoothly.

I tried to search for remedies including flushing my DNS through the command prompt on windows 8 and then restarted it - nothing happened.

And then I tried to change some settings in my DNS server-in the TCP/IPv4. I changed the Preferred DNS server to 8.8.8.8, alternate to 8.8.4.4., I saw that nothing happened so I flushed my DNS again and restarted and then it finally worked.

The mysterious thing was the next day, I started to use my iPad and note 5, they worked fine at first but then suddenly I can't surf the net (again) and it said that there wasn't an internet connection. (Though youtube was doing perfectly fine, again. Until it looses the ability to stream videos an hour later.)

And now, I really feel weird since I am the only one who is able to use the internet (through my laptop), since all of the mobile devices here in the house are unable to connect to the net.

I am hoping that someone could explain this to me and tell me what to do:) I am sorry if the story was kinda terrible, please comment if you want to clarify something. :) I really wanted to get this fixed but I don't know how, since the tech support of our internet is lame.
